Joseph S. Gots is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Organic Chemistry and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Joseph S. Gots has authored 60 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 44 papers in Molecular Biology, 10 papers in Organic Chemistry and 10 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Joseph S. Gots's work include Biochemical and Molecular Research (32 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(10 papers) and H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(7 papers). Joseph S. Gots is often cited by papers focused on Biochemical and Molecular Research (32 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(10 papers) and H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(7 papers). Joseph S. Gots collaborates with scholars based in United States and Denmark. Joseph S. Gots's co-authors include Takeshi Yokota, Arnold F. Brodie, Edith Gollub, Charles E. Benson, Samuel H. Love, John M. Smith, Susan Shumas, Carl A. Westby, S. Friedman and Raju K. Koduri and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
